Comprendre le Gas sur Ethereum : Le Carburant de la Blockchain

Thomas Mercier

  • 🔍 Découvrez le rôle essentiel du Gas dans chaque transaction Ethereum.
  • ⛽️ Apprenez comment le Gas influence le coût et la sécurité des transactions.
  • 📈 Comprenez la dynamique du marché des transactions prioritaires.
  • 💡 Explorez des stratégies pour optimiser vos frais de Gas et éviter les pièges.
  • 🚀 Plongez dans les outils et astuces pour naviguer efficacement sur le réseau Ethereum.

Vous vous êtes déjà demandé comment fonctionne réellement la blockchain Ethereum ? Le concept de Gas sur Ethereum est au cœur de son fonctionnement, jouant un rôle crucial dans chaque transaction. Imaginez le Gas comme le carburant qui fait tourner le moteur de cette puissante machine décentralisée. Sans lui, aucune opération ne serait possible sur le réseau.

Dans cet article, nous allons plonger au cœur du système de Gas d’Ethereum pour comprendre son fonctionnement, son importance et son impact sur l’écosystème crypto. Que vous soyez un investisseur chevronné ou un curieux de la blockchain, cette exploration du « carburant d’Ethereum » vous permettra de mieux appréhender les enjeux et les opportunités de cette technologie révolutionnaire.

Préparez-vous à découvrir comment le Gas influence le coût de vos transactions, pourquoi il est essentiel pour la sécurité du réseau, et comment vous pouvez optimiser son utilisation. Embarquez pour un voyage fascinant au cœur du moteur économique d’Ethereum !

Qu’est-ce que le Gas et pourquoi est-il crucial pour Ethereum ?

Imaginez Ethereum comme une immense machine virtuelle mondiale. Chaque opération sur cette machine – qu’il s’agisse d’un simple transfert d’Ether ou de l’exécution d’un smart contract complexe – nécessite de l’énergie pour fonctionner. C’est là qu’intervient le Gas.

Le Gas est l’unité qui mesure la quantité de travail computationnel nécessaire pour effectuer des opérations sur le réseau Ethereum. Pensez-y comme au carburant qui fait tourner le moteur de cette machine virtuelle. Chaque transaction ou exécution de contrat consomme une certaine quantité de Gas, déterminée par la complexité de l’opération.

A LIRE AUSSI  Guide complet : utiliser MyEtherWallet facilement 🚀

Mais pourquoi est-ce si important ? Le système de Gas joue plusieurs rôles cruciaux :

  • Il prévient les boucles infinies et autres abus du réseau en limitant la quantité de travail qu’une opération peut demander.
  • Il récompense les mineurs (bientôt validateurs avec Ethereum 2.0) pour leur travail de sécurisation et de validation des transactions.
  • Il crée un marché pour la priorité des transactions, permettant aux utilisateurs de « payer plus » pour que leurs transactions soient traitées plus rapidement.

Selon les données de Etherscan, le prix moyen du Gas a connu des fluctuations importantes, allant de quelques Gwei à plusieurs centaines lors des pics d’activité du réseau. Ces variations ont un impact direct sur le coût des transactions et l’accessibilité du réseau Ethereum.

Vous vous demandez peut-être : « Comment puis-je naviguer dans ce système complexe ? » Ne vous inquiétez pas, nous allons explorer ensemble les différents aspects du Gas et comment l’optimiser pour vos besoins.

Comment fonctionne concrètement le Gas sur Ethereum ?

Comprendre la Gas Limit et le Gas Price

Lorsque vous effectuez une transaction sur Ethereum, vous devez spécifier deux paramètres clés liés au Gas :

  • Gas Limit : C’est la quantité maximale de Gas que vous êtes prêt à dépenser pour votre transaction. Pensez-y comme à un plein d’essence avant un long voyage.
  • Gas Price : C’est le prix que vous êtes prêt à payer pour chaque unité de Gas. Il s’exprime généralement en Gwei, une fraction d’Ether (1 Gwei = 0.000000001 ETH).

Le coût total de votre transaction sera donc : Gas utilisé × Gas Price. Si votre Gas Limit est trop bas, votre transaction pourrait échouer, mais vous perdrez quand même le Gas dépensé. Trop haut, et vous gaspillez potentiellement des fonds.

Sélectionner les transactions à valider

Les mineurs (bientôt validateurs) jouent un rôle crucial dans ce processus. Ils choisissent généralement les transactions avec le Gas Price le plus élevé pour maximiser leurs revenus. C’est pourquoi, lors des périodes de forte congestion du réseau, les prix du Gas peuvent monter en flèche.

Selon Ethereum.org, le protocole EIP-1559, implémenté en août 2021, a introduit un système de frais de base brûlés et de pourboires optionnels pour les mineurs, visant à rendre les frais de Gas plus prévisibles et efficaces.

A LIRE AUSSI  Vitalik Buterin secoue Ethereum : le remaniement polémique

Vous vous demandez peut-être comment naviguer dans ce système complexe ? Ne vous inquiétez pas, il existe des outils pour vous aider à estimer les coûts et optimiser vos transactions.

Comment estimer et optimiser vos coûts en Gas ?

Diagramme montrant une balance entre le coût et la vitesse de transaction, avec des canisters de gaz pour optimiser les transactions Ethereum.

Utiliser des outils d’estimation du Gas

Pour éviter les mauvaises surprises, plusieurs outils peuvent vous aider à estimer les coûts en Gas avant d’effectuer une transaction :

  • ETH Gas Station : Fournit des estimations en temps réel des prix du Gas pour différentes vitesses de confirmation.
  • MetaMask : Le portefeuille populaire offre des estimations de Gas directement dans son interface.
  • Etherscan Gas Tracker : Offre une vue d’ensemble des tendances de prix du Gas.

Ces outils vous permettront de prendre des décisions éclairées sur le moment et le coût de vos transactions.

Stratégies d’optimisation des frais

Voici quelques astuces pour réduire vos frais de Gas :

  1. Choisissez le bon moment : Les prix du Gas fluctuent en fonction de l’activité du réseau. Les week-ends et les heures creuses sont souvent moins chers.
  2. Utilisez des solutions Layer 2 : Des plateformes comme Arbitrum ou Optimism offrent des transactions à moindre coût tout en bénéficiant de la sécurité d’Ethereum.
  3. Optimisez vos smart contracts : Si vous êtes développeur, des outils comme Remix IDE peuvent vous aider à optimiser votre code pour consommer moins de Gas.

Rappelez-vous, l’optimisation du Gas est un équilibre entre coût et rapidité. Parfois, payer un peu plus peut être judicieux pour une confirmation rapide d’une transaction importante.

Éviter les pièges courants

Même les utilisateurs expérimentés peuvent tomber dans certains pièges liés au Gas :

  • Boucles infinies : Un code mal optimisé peut consommer tout votre Gas sans accomplir la tâche souhaitée.
  • Gas inutilisé : Définir une Gas Limit trop élevée peut vous faire perdre des fonds inutilement.
  • Sous-estimation des coûts : Particulièrement problématique lors de l’interaction avec des smart contracts complexes.

Pour éviter ces pièges, testez toujours vos transactions sur des réseaux de test comme Goerli avant de les exécuter sur le réseau principal Ethereum.

A LIRE AUSSI  Justin Sun veut Ethereum à 10 000 $ : ses stratégies chocs

Vous vous sentez prêt à plonger dans le monde fascinant du Gas Ethereum ? N’oubliez pas que la pratique est la clé. Commencez par de petites transactions, utilisez les outils à votre disposition, et n’hésitez pas à consulter la communauté Ethereum pour des conseils personnalisés.

Pour une meilleure maîtrise de vos transactions Ethereum

Maintenant que vous comprenez mieux le fonctionnement du Gas sur Ethereum, vous avez toutes les cartes en main pour optimiser vos transactions. Rappelez-vous que le Gas n’est pas qu’un simple coût à payer, mais un mécanisme essentiel qui permet au réseau Ethereum de fonctionner de manière sécurisée et efficace. En utilisant les outils d’estimation, en choisissant les bons moments pour vos transactions, et en explorant les solutions Layer 2, vous pouvez significativement réduire vos frais tout en profitant pleinement de l’écosystème Ethereum.

Vous souhaitez approfondir vos connaissances sur l’écosystème Ethereum ? Rejoignez notre newsletter hebdomadaire pour recevoir nos derniers articles sur la blockchain, des conseils pratiques pour optimiser vos transactions, et des analyses détaillées des nouvelles tendances DeFi. N’attendez plus pour devenir un expert de la blockchain !

Thomas Mercier

Laisser un commentaire